Undergraduate Certificate Student Diversity

For the most recent academic year available, 41% of entrepreneurial studies undergraduate certificate degrees went to men and 59% went to women.

GTC gender breakdown of Entrepreneurial Studies Undergraduate Certificate degree grads The majority of entrepreneurial studies undergraduate certificate degree graduates at GTC were White. About 74%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Greenville Technical College with a undergraduate certificate in entrepreneurial studies.

Ethnic diversity of Entrepreneurial Studies majors at Greenville Technical College
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 1
Black or African American 5
Hispanic or Latino 4
White 34
Non-Resident Aliens 0
Other Races 2
